Nestled at the foothills of the Rwenzori Mountains, Fort Portal is a charming town known for its breathtaking scenery, cool climate, and rich cultural heritage. As the gateway to Kibale Forest National Park, Fort Portal is the perfect base for adventurers seeking to explore Uganda’s natural beauty. The town is surrounded by stunning crater lakes, each offering unique hiking opportunities and panoramic views. Don’t miss a visit to Lake Nyinambuga, famously featured on Uganda’s 20,000 shilling note.
For history buffs, the Amabere Ga Nyina Mwiru Caves are a must-see. These ancient limestone caves are steeped in local legend and surrounded by waterfalls, making for a magical and mystical experience. Fort Portal is also known for its lush tea plantations, where you can take guided tours to learn about tea production while enjoying the scenic rolling hills.
Fort Portal’s vibrant local markets and friendly people make it a delightful town to explore on foot. The town’s cool climate offers a refreshing break from the heat, making it an ideal destination for both relaxation and adventure. After a day of exploring, unwind at one of the town’s cozy cafes or lodges,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scapes.
Fort Portal is more than just a stopover; it’s a destination in its own right. Whether you’re trekking with chimpanzees in Kibale Forest, hiking the Rwenzori Mountains, or simply soaking in the scenic beauty, Fort Portal offers an unforgettable escape into Uganda’s natural wonders.
